In comes Seb
2011 - Uruguayan centre-half Sebastián Coates signed from Nacional for £7m after impressing at the recent Copa América tournament. He has so far netted once in twelve senior outings for the reds.
Masch off
2010 - Javier Mascherano was sold to Barcelona for €22m, after two goals in 139 reds games. He signed for the reds on loan from West Ham United in January 2007, joining permanently thirteen months later.
A hat-trick for Michael
1998 - Michael Owen bagged a hat-trick as we beat Newcastle United 4-1 at St. James' Park, to spoil Ruud Gullit's first game in charge. Stéphane Guivarc'h replied for the home side with Patrik Berger rounding out the scoring, which all took place in the first half.
The Saint off the mark
1961 - Ian St. John struck his first two reds goals as we trounced Sunderland 4-1, with Roger Hunt also on target twice and Brian Clough netting for the home side.

Harry off and running
2003 - Harry Kewell netted his first reds goal as we won 3-0 at Everton, with Michael Owen bagging a brace. This was our fourth straight League win at Goodison, a record for any club.
Out of Anfield
2002 - Jari Litmanen rejoined his old club Ajax on a free transfer. He had only managed to make nineteen starts in as many months at Anfield, notching nine goals in 43 appearances in all, and failed to really establish himself back in the Netherlands.
2006 - Neil Mellor joined Preston North End for a reported £0.5m. He netted 43 times in 151 outings before having to retire due to injury last May.
1999 - Bjørn Tore Kvarme signed for Saint-Étienne on a free transfer. He had made 54 reds appearances, but was not the defensive missing link we were searching for. He spent two seasons in France before joining Sander Westerveld at Real Sociedad, retiring from the game in June 2008 after a spell back with his first club, Rosenborg BK.
1990 - Reserves defender Alex Watson joined Derby County on loan, going on to make five appearances for the Rams. His brother Dave, another ex-reds reserve, went on to far greater success with Everton.
Also off the mark
1919 - Inside-forward Harry Lewis, Harry ‘Smiler' Chambers and outside-left Albert Pearson all scored on their reds debuts, as we won 3-1 at Bradford City as another season began.
1933 - Forward Sam English scored his first reds goal in our 1-1 draw with Stoke City at Anfield, the first time we had faced them since their name change from the simpler Stoke.
We have beaten Stoke City twice more on this day over the years.
1947 - Billy Liddell struck a brace as we won 2-0 at the Victoria Ground.
1952 - We won 3-2 in L4 with Jack Smith, Kevin Baron and Billy Liddell on the scoresheet.
Happy birthday Seb
1986 - Winger Sebastián Leto was born in Alejandro Korn in Buenos Aires, Argentina. He signed from Club Atlético Lanús for £1.85m in January 2007, although the transfer was not formally completed until seven months later. He made just four senior appearances, and moved permanently to Panathinaikos in July 2009 after spending the previous season on loan at Olympiacos.
Out-foxed
We twice visited Filbert Street to play Leicester City on this day in the 1970's, without winning.
1972 - We lost 3-2 with John Toshack bagging an early brace to put us two goals ahead, before Keith Weller struck a hat-trick.
1975 - We were held 1-1, with Kevin Keegan nabbing our goal. Two minutes earlier he had converted a penalty, but had to retake it, and failed with his second attempt. Keith Weller netted against the reds again.

Heading towards Wembley
1977 - Kenny Dalglish and Jimmy Case were on the scoresheet as we beat Chelsea 2-0 at Anfield in a League Cup Second Round fixture. We went on to reach the Final of the competition for the first time that season.
East end Hutch
1994 - Don Hutchison left Anfield for West Ham United for £1.5m after ten goals in sixty reds games.
2001 - He moved back to Upton Park, joining from Sunderland for £5m, having also played for Sheffield United and Everton in the meantime.
